Alejandro was born and raised in Colombia. He received his mining and metallurgy engineering degree and his master’s degree from the School of Mines in the Universidad Nacional de Colombia (UNAL). Alejandro spent his career at UNAL developing projects for Colombian national and regional Agencies, NGOs, and companies. He was an instructor at the School of Mines at UNAL in subjects such as mining economics, mine closure, and mining, and sustainable development. He did academic coordination of three versions of the Colombian Mining Congress (2013, 2014, and 2016), and participated in the Civil Society Table of the Extractive Industry Transparency Initiative – EITI in Colombia between 2013 and 2018. In January 2019, Alejandro joined the NSF-PIRE project Responsible Mining, Resilient Communities, and the Mining Geology Research Group. Since 2020, He is a part of the Communities and Resources Research Group.
